12th Sept 2002

(1) Although 3 out of 4 of these units were carrying South Kansas & Oklahoma Railroad markings this picture was taken on the branch of the Watco system known as the Stillwater Central, a line reaching across Oklahoma between Sapulpa and Duke in the south west of the state. The line passes through Oklahoma City. Running rights allow the railroad to run over BNSF tracks into Tulsa and the connection with the South Kansas & Oklahoma Railroad system (SKOL) proper. This system is centred on Cherryvale in South Kansas.
On the outskirts of Sapulpa this train is waiting to access the BNSF line in order to continue to Tulsa. The crew were patiently waiting on the right side of an open grade crossing and when asked were perfectly happy to invite us into the cab for a chat! The train started out from Oklahoma City and was terminating at Tulsa, carrying 8 loads of gypsum and 22 empty cement cars. The train is seen at 11.30 with the following units on the head end:
#7012 - GP-7
#2211 - GP-7
#4112 - GP-30
#2186 - GP-7, in Stillwater Central colours
